css实用技巧及必须得注意的事项


个人总结的一些css实用技巧及必须得注意的事项:

1.注释须知:html中注释不能这样写:

<div></div><!--------这是错误写法------->
<div></div><!--=======这是正确写法========-->

这种写法,FF中会忽略其下面的内容.

2.CSS注释切记在/*之后及*/之前空一格,否则在有些语言中会出问题,正确写法:

#div{style}/* 注释前后要空格 */

3.最简单区分IE与FF的HACK写法:

#layer{
    padding-top:20px;/* FF中定义 */
    *padding-top:10px;/* IE中定义 */
}

4.空div在IE(FF中没有)是有默认高度的,可以用定义:

div { witdh:100%; background:#9c0; ling-height:0}

的方式去掉默认高度.
5.按钮按下时立体感效果:

a:hover { position:relative; top:1px; left:1px}/* 切记一定要是相对定位 */

6.关闭当前页面代码:

<div onclick="window.close();">关闭当前页面</div>

7.整站变灰代码(加到样式表中):

html { filter:progid:DXImageTransform.Microsoft.BasicImage(grayscale=1);}

8.设为首页代码:

<span onclick="var strHref=window.location.href;this.style.behavior='url(#default#homepage)';this.setHomePage('http://www.phpstudy.net');" style="CURSOR:hand">设为首页</span>

9.加入收藏代码:

<script language="JavaScript">
function phpstudycom()
{window.external.addFavorite('http://www.phpstudy.net','phpstudy.Com');}
if (document.all)document.write('<a href="##" onClick="phpstudycom();" title="把“phpstudy.Com”加入您的收藏夹!">收藏本站</a>')
</script>


« 
» 
快速导航

Copyright © 2016 phpStudy | 豫ICP备2021030365号-3